Let's say you went for a whole day trip and were biking for 7 hours straight. Input all of these values into the calorie burned formula: calories = T × 60 × MET × 3.5 × W / 200. calories = 7 × 60 × 9.5 × 3.5 × 90 / 200 = 6284 kcal. Finally, divide this value by 7700 to obtain your weight loss: 6284 / 7700 = 0.82 kg.

Most …This number represents the steps you need to walk daily to achieve your desired weight loss. Example: Emma wants to create a 500-calorie deficit daily and burns 0.04 calories per step. To find out how many steps she needs to walk, she divides her calorie goal by the calories burned per step: Emma’s steps per day = 500 / 0.04 = 12,500 steps.4. Use your arms. ' A strong-arm motion can ...Performance Level (Relative Speed): Formula: Performance Level = (Your Speed / Average Speed of Reference Population) x 100. Example: If your walking speed is 6 kilometers per hour, and the average speed of a reference population is 5 kilometers per hour, your performance level is (6 / 5) x 100 = 120%.
